One woman has been killed in a fast-moving wildfire in western Canada, police said, as authorities declared a state of emergency and ordered thousands of residents to flee their homes.The wildfire, which was first detected on Friday, has since doubled in size and continues to spread rapidly.The Bald Range fire has spread across more than 53 square miles (136 sq km) in Summerland, Peachland and other parts of British Columbia, according to the BC Wildfire Service."We have to brace ourselves for the worst," Summerland Mayor Doug Holmes told Reuters.

The entire Summerland area has been ordered to evacuate, along with thousands of residents in nearby communities.Officials said the flames were so intense that they generated their own weather systems, which in turn can produce lightning.British Columbia Premier David Eby told a news conference on Saturday that one fire official had compared the blaze to "a bomb going off"."Homes have been lost, and properties have been destroyed.

Some people became trapped as conditions changed very quickly, and needed to be rescued," Eby said.The state of emergency gives the provincial government special powers, including imposing travel restrictions, protecting supplies to prevent price gouging and deploying additional resources to coordinate rescue operations.Summerland, which has a population of about 12,000, has been among the worst-hit areas and was placed under an evacuation order.

Residents in parts of Peachland, a community of about 6,500 people, were also ordered to evacuate."We have been on evacuation alert many times," Earl Kurz, a Peachland resident of 30 years was quoted as saying by the BBC. "This is the first time we were actually evacuated."Hundreds of wildfires have been reported across Canada this summer, including nearly 200 that were burning in Ontario in July.
